does anyone know why i’m getting a null date value after putting this thru my date formatter?

    //Sets expire date for listing to String
NSString *expireDate = [[_itemDetailArray valueForKey:@"expireDate"]description]; //returns my date correctly

NSString *formattedStringDate = [NSString stringWithFormat:@"%@",[formatter dateFromString:expireDate]]; //comes out null

Any ideas why?

    Your formatter’s format is wrong. Try with this

    [formatter setDateFormat:@"yyyy-MM-dd hh:mm:ss zzz"];
